Business Development Fellow

BEAM Circular is focused on transforming waste into opportunities and building a vibrant ecosystem for the circular bioeconomy in California’s agricultural heartland. The Business Development Fellow will support the Vice President of Business and Economic Development in developing commercial relationships necessary for biomanufacturing companies to thrive in the North San Joaquin Valley.

Responsibilities

Conduct proactive outreach to biomanufacturing companies and commercial partners, including suppliers, offtakers, logistics providers, and service firms
Assess company needs and partnership requirements; connect firms with relevant NSJV partners and BEAM resources
Facilitate strategic introductions that support commercialization, siting, and regional expansion
Support the business attraction and expansion pipeline through targeted outreach, materials preparation, and coordinated follow-up
Maintain working relationships with industry associations, corporate partners, and regional stakeholders
Support the VP of Business and Economic Development in building and curating a network of technical, operational, engineering, and analytical service providers aligned with biomanufacturing needs
Identify, engage, and help vet or verify companies for inclusion in the BEAM Service Provider Network
Coordinate closely with BEAM’s innovation and economic development teams to integrate service-provider capabilities into commercialization support programs
Maintain active communication with service providers to track new capabilities, capacity expansions, or strategic interests relevant to BEAM’s pipeline
Support the VP of Business and Economic Development in coordinating outreach and partnerships across cities, counties, utilities, and economic development organizations
Work with the California Bioindustrial Manufacturing Coalition (CBIO) Industry Development Steering Committee to support alignment with statewide business development efforts
Support preparation of briefing memos, partner profiles, pitch decks, and outbound outreach materials
Translate insights from partner meetings and industry engagement into practical recommendations to strengthen NSJV’s competitiveness as a biomanufacturing hub
